AIKIDO
The Japanese martial art of Aikido is one of the most modern of the martial arts, but its roots go back to the sword fighting techniques of the Samurai. Founded by O’Sensei Morihei Ueshiba, Aikido combines physical discipline and practical effectiveness with an emphasis on personal and spiritual growth. More... OUR DOJO

YOSHINKAN AIKIDO
One of the earliest and most talented students of the founder of Aikido was Gozo Shioda. He was very energetic and studied with O’Sensei Ueshiba for many years. With the masters blessing he founded the Yoshinkan style of Aikido. Yoshinkan literally means “House for the cultivation of the spirit”. More... OUR INSTRUCTORS
